You need to make sure of gathering blood samples carefully and then labeling and cataloging them professionally as well. Writing right plays only an important role here-if a sample isn't labeled properly, the individual might be misdiagnosed and treated with the wrong medications. Thus, as part of your phlebotomy training, you must learn to pay attention to such details. Although every state will not make becoming certified a essential, most employers believe it is. Given the choice between hiring someone having a proven ability and knowledge level, from a trusted agency and someone without it, most go with the man who is certified.
